Desalination technologies help address the world's growing water scarcity problem. Desalination is the process of removing salt and other minerals from seawater and brackish water to make them useable for drinking, irrigation, industrial uses, etc. However, challenges associated with desalination processes persist, including high energy consumption, high costs, and environmental concerns such as brine disposal.

This book provides an overview of desalination technologies, their underlying principles and their process and system design and operation. The authors explore advancements in automation,  waste reduction, and other technological innovations in the field of water purification. Environmental impacts related to desalination are also discussed, including the resulting increase in seawater’s salt level, the impact of chemicals and brine discharge, and the contamination by the chemicals used in the process.
